Blogs We Love: I’m an Organizing Junkie

I’m an Organizing Junkie is an awesome blog!  I found Laura way back when I first starting putting blogs in my Google Reader.  She is also the person who inspired me to start menu planning. She has Menu Planning Mondays, where everyone can link their weekly meal plan up to her post!  There were over 400 links on the last MPM post.  I need to get back into this habit this spring.  Hopefully I will be posting my menu plans soon!  This is my favorite little banner to use for menu planning!

Laura also encourages her readers to organize in fun ways and shows pictures of organizational tools that she loves (i.e. storage bins).  She occasionally has challenges (like February was a 28 day cleaning challenge) and also what she calls Storage Stars. They are awards given to readers who come up with great storage solutions.  For instance this “closet where one did not exist before” was featured last week.  Very cool.

Blogs We Love: WeddingBee

Megan and I subscribe to about 200 blogs. I know what you’re thinking: If we love blogs so much, why don’t we marry them? Well, for one it’s not legal. Secondly, we like our Matts too much. So, instead, we thought we would debut this fun series during Wedding Week, to show our undying devotion.

For those of you who got a ring on it, so to speak, or even for those who haven’t received official confirmation quite yet, I present to you a wonderful wedding planning site: WeddingBee.com.

WeddingBee has brides under cute pseudonyms blog their way through the planning process. Reading through the ups and downs of planning is like having friends right alongside you. Perhaps my favorite part is the can-do spirit of the bloggers. Many of them tackle their own projects — Miss Poodle even made her own dress! — and show you how to do it. They also manage to find good deals and inspirations that were very helpful to me in trying to figure out the world of weddings.
